Home » Survey finds developers value AI for ideas, not final answers

Survey finds developers value AI for ideas, not final answers

by Jamal Richaqrds

AI for Developers: A Tool for Ideas, Not Final Answers

In the realm of software development, the integration of artificial intelligence (AI) has been met with a cautious embrace by developers. While AI has the potential to revolutionize the way code is written and applications are built, developers are currently utilizing this technology more for learning and ideation rather than for generating final production-ready solutions.

According to a recent survey conducted among developers, it was found that the majority view AI as a valuable tool for sparking ideas and exploring new possibilities within their projects. Instead of relying on AI to provide final answers or complete pieces of code, developers are leveraging this technology to enhance their own problem-solving skills and streamline their workflows.

One of the main reasons developers are using AI for learning rather than production code is the inherent complexity of AI algorithms and models. While AI can offer suggestions and automate certain tasks, developers are still required to have a deep understanding of the underlying principles in order to effectively integrate AI into their projects. By using AI as a learning tool, developers can enhance their knowledge and skills in AI technology, allowing them to make more informed decisions about its application in their work.

Furthermore, developers value the creative potential that AI brings to the table. By using AI to generate ideas, developers can explore new approaches and solutions that they may not have considered otherwise. AI can analyze vast amounts of data and patterns, providing developers with valuable insights and inspiration that can fuel their creativity and innovation.

For example, AI-powered code suggestion tools can help developers write code more efficiently by offering autocomplete suggestions and identifying potential errors. This not only speeds up the coding process but also helps developers learn best practices and improve their coding skills over time.

Moreover, AI can assist developers in optimizing their workflows and enhancing productivity. By automating repetitive tasks and providing intelligent insights, AI can free up developers’ time to focus on more complex and high-value aspects of their projects. This can lead to faster development cycles, improved code quality, and ultimately, more successful and impactful software applications.

In conclusion, while developers are cautiously embracing AI in their work, they are primarily using this technology for generating ideas and enhancing their learning experience rather than relying on it for final answers or production-ready code. By leveraging AI as a tool for creativity, learning, and optimization, developers can unlock new possibilities and drive innovation in the ever-evolving landscape of software development.

AI, Developers, Ideas, Learning, Productivity

You may also like

This website uses cookies to improve your experience. We'll assume you're ok with this, but you can opt-out if you wish. Accept Read More